Plot Worlds Explained
JPlots offers two different ways to handle plots on your server: dedicated plot worlds and SMP mode. Understanding the difference helps you choose the right setup for your server.Dedicated Plot Worlds (Default)
By default, JPlots uses dedicated plot worlds. This is the traditional approach where you have specific worlds set aside just for plots.How It Works
- Plots can only be created in worlds you specify in the config
- The entire world is treated as a plot area

When SMP mode is disabled, the plugin applies world-wide settings to plot worlds, like disabling PvP, preventing mob spawning, and other protection features across the entire world.
SMP Mode
SMP mode is perfect when you want plots to work alongside a normal survival world. Instead of having separate plot worlds, plots can exist anywhere!How It Works
- Plots can be created in any world on your server
- Protection only applies inside plot boundaries
- Areas outside plots behave normally (PvP, mobs, etc.)
- Great for survival servers where you want plot protection in specific areas

When to Use SMP Mode
SMP mode is ideal when:- You want plots in your main survival world
- You need plot protection in specific areas only
- Players should be able to build freely outside plots
When to Use Dedicated Plot Worlds
Stick with dedicated plot worlds when:- You’re running a boxpvp or gens server
- You want all plots in separate dimensions
